The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s advertised in Birmingham requiring AngularJS sk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 28 February 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
28 Feb 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 69 53 55
Rank change year-on-year -16 +2 +12
Contract jobs citing AngularJS 11 2 14
As % of all contract jobs in Birmingham 1.28% 0.36% 1.84%
As % of the Libraries, Frameworks & Software Standards category 6.08% 1.85% 10.77%
Number of daily rates quoted 4 1 11
10th Percentile £419 - £238
25th Percentile £447 £575 £338
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£475 £600 £400
Median % change year-on-year -20.83% +50.00% -11.11%
75th Percentile £488 £625 £438
90th Percentile - - £475
West Midlands median daily rate £449 £475 £425
% change year-on-year -5.58% +11.76% -17.07%
Number of hourly rates quoted 0 0 1
Median hourly rate - - £56.25
West Midlands median hourly rate - - £56.25
